Hinge Health raises $437 million in its IPO

Digital physical therapy startup Hinge Health raised $437 million in its IPO, pricing at the top of its $28-$32 per share range.
By the numbers: The offering makes Hinge Health worth about $2.6 billion — nearly a 52% haircut from its $6.2 billion valuation in 2021.
It will trade on the NYSE under ticker symbol "HNGE."
The big picture: Hinge is using AI-powered physical therapy sensors that give patients live feedback on how they're progressing with an exercise.
Zoom in: Hinge posted $123.8 million in revenue in Q1 of this year (vs. $82.7 million in Q1 of 2024).
Hinge reported a $12 million net loss on $390 million in revenue for 2024, compared to a $108 million net loss on $293 million in revenue the year prior.
Gross margins were 81%, an increase from Q1 2024's 70%.
Flashback: The company had raised $800 million in VC funding from firms like Atomico, Insight Partners, Tiger Global, Coatue, Insight Partners, TCV, Industry Ventures, and Bessemer Venture Partners.

HIVE Digital Capacity Crosses 10 EH/s in May, Aims to More Than Double That by Year-End

Bitcoin miner HIVE Digital Technologies (HIVE) has surpassed 10 exahash per second (EH/s) in hashrate capacity, a 58% increase from April, driven by the launch of a 100-megawatt hydro-powered site in Paraguay. The company said in a press release on Friday that it's on track to reach 25 EH/s by the end of 2025. The firm mined 139 bitcoin in May, or an average rate of 4.5 BTC per day. Peak capacity hit 10.4 EH/s while average hashrate for the month stood at 8.5 EH/s. HIVE said its fleet efficiency remained steady at around 20 joules per terahash (J/TH), and its network share now exceeds 1% of global Bitcoin mining power. The new facility in Paraguay reflects a broader trend in the mining industry: the race to deploy next-generation ASIC miners rapidly and at scale in regions with abundant renewable power. Co-founder Frank Holmes emphasized the company's speed and flexibility, pointing to its Buzz HPC division, which supports AI cloud infrastructure alongside Bitcoin mining. CEO Aydin Kilic said the company's goal for the summer is 18 EH/s, and that fleet upgrades should allow for a daily BTC output of over 12 by the fourth quarter — potentially at a production cost below $50,000 per coin. HIVE operates facilities in Canada, Sweden and Paraguay, powered entirely by hydroelectricity. The company was the first publicly listed crypto miner on the TSX Venture Exchange in 2017. HIVE shares are higher by 13% in New York trade on Friday as the mining sector rallies alongside bitcoin's gain to above $105,000.

Oncoscope Officially Launches, Ushering in a New Era of Real Time Oncology Intelligence

06/06/2025, Miami, Florida // PRODIGY: Feature Story // Anna Forsythe, founder of Oncoscope-AI (source: Oncoscope-AI) Oncoscope-AI, a revolutionary oncology intelligence platform, has officially launched following a successful beta phase and over a year of strategic development that involved extensive conversations with practicing oncologists. The platform, which delivers real-time, human-curated cancer insights enhanced by artificial intelligence, is now live and available free of charge to verified healthcare professionals worldwide. Founded by Anna Forsythe, a pharmacist, health economist, and seasoned pharmaceutical executive, Oncoscope addresses a critical gap in oncology care. It gives clinicians instant access to the most current treatment data, FDA approvals, and guideline-aligned information, consolidated into one user-friendly platform. 'Doctors do not need more data. They need the right information, at the right time, in a format they can use to make better decisions for their patients,' said Forsythe. 'Oncoscope provides that clarity. It is a living library of oncology, curated by experts and built to save lives.' Unlike generic AI tools or static databases, Oncoscope uses trained AI to scan thousands of oncology publications and filters them through a rigorous, evidence-based framework. Each entry is cross-referenced with clinical guidelines and regulatory approvals to ensure usability and relevance. All of the results are carefully scrutinized by a team of experienced researchers. Currently, the platform supports breast and lung cancer, with prostate, bladder, colon, and rectal modules rolling out in the coming months. The process is intuitive. Physicians answer three clinical questions—cancer stage, genetic markers, and prior treatments—and receive a personalized, actionable summary. Each recommended article includes survival data, progression insights, treatment efficacy, and toxicity, extracted across 32 key clinical parameters. 'The result is something physicians can actually use in the moment,' said Forsythe. 'It takes three clicks to go from a patient in the room to the most up-to-date evidence in the field.' Access to Oncoscope is free for verified healthcare professionals, including physicians, nurses, pharmacists, genetic counselors, and physician assistants. Non-verified users, such as those in finance or consulting, can purchase limited access at a monthly rate, restricted to a single cancer type. Japanese AI Unicorn Notta Enters Otter AI's Market with Innovative Smart Voice Recorder

Notta Bets Big on AI Agent-Powered Voice Recorder as Hardware-SaaS Convergence Accelerates TOKYO, June 6, 2025 /PRNewswire/ -- As OpenAI's ChatGPT dominates enterprise AI adoption and Google Gemini reshapes how businesses think about AI assistants, Japanese unicorn Notta announced its ambitious push into the U.S. hardware market with the Notta Memo AI Voice Recorder. From Tokyo to Silicon Valley: The Underdog Story Notta's journey reads like a classic tech disruption playbook, albeit with a Japanese twist. Since launching in 2020, the company has quietly built a formidable AI transcription empire, amassing over 10 million users globally and signing up 4,000 enterprise customers. The real validation? A staggering 68% of Japan's Nikkei 225 companies—the country's most elite corporations—have integrated Notta's AI solutions into their workflows. 'Most observers underestimate just how competitive the Japanese enterprise market is,' explains industry analyst Sarah from TechInsight Research. 'If you can win over two-thirds of the Nikkei 225, you've proven enterprise-grade reliability at scale.' Notta's 2022 Airgram acquisition was just the opening move—the company believes the real opportunity lies in completely reimagining how voice technology integrates into daily workflows. Security-First Approach Gives Notta Enterprise Edge Unlike many AI startups that retrofit compliance as an afterthought, Notta built enterprise security into its foundation from day one. The company holds ISO/IEC 27001 and SOC 2 Type II certifications—credentials that remain elusive for many competitors still scrambling to meet Fortune 500 requirements. More critically, Notta has secured the regulatory trifecta that unlocks major markets: GDPR compliance for European expansion, HIPAA certification for healthcare disruption, and CCPA adherence for California's privacy-conscious landscape. This compliance-first strategy positions Notta to compete for high-value enterprise contracts that security-conscious organizations won't trust to less mature platforms. Hardware Meets AI: The Five-Platform Ecosystem Play The Notta Memo distinguishes itself in the crowded voice recording market through its unique five-platform ecosystem integration—seamlessly connecting web, iOS, Android, Chrome extension, and the Memo device itself. This comprehensive approach addresses the fragmented user experience that has long plagued the industry. Unlike traditional voice recording solutions that force users to choose between SaaS flexibility and hardware reliability, Notta Memo delivers both. The device features advanced bone-conduction technology for complete phone call recording, intelligent noise reduction for crystal-clear audio capture, and one-tap synchronization with Notta.
